How long does it take to cook raw chicken in a crock pot?

Place the chicken and stock, broth, or water in a 4-quart or larger slow cooker.

Cook the chicken.

Cover and cook until the chicken is tender and registers an internal temperature of 165°F, 4 to 5 hours on the LOW setting, or 2 to 3 hours on the HIGH setting.13 Jan 2020

Can you put raw chicken in a slow cooker?

Raw chicken, just cooked on a low setting, will usually cook in 4-6 hours if you haven’t overfilled your slow cooker with ingredients. The more sauce in the pot and the fewer pieces of chicken, the shorter time’s needed.

How do I keep chicken from drying out in the crockpot?

To prevent poultry from drying out, use chicken thighs—they have more fat and won’t dry out as quickly, says Finlayson. Cook thighs for about six hours and breasts for a maximum of five hours on low heat. Beef, depending on the cut, is much more forgiving, she says.17 Aug 2014

Is it better to slow cook on low or high?

The only difference between the HIGH and LOW setting on a slow cooker is the amount of time it takes to reach the simmer point, or temperature at which the contents of the appliance are being cooked at. The LOW setting takes longer than the HIGH setting. This means most recipes can be cooked on either setting.

Can you overcook chicken in the crockpot?

Can you overcook chicken in the slow cooker? Yes, it is possible! If the meat is cooked too long it could end up dry and not juicy and tender.

Is it safe to cook chicken in a crockpot on low?

Crock-Pots and other slow cookers are safe for preparing foods, including meat and poultry, as long as you use the device correctly. The low- and high-heat settings on the Crock-Pot reach a hot enough temperature to kill potential bacteria from the chicken.

Do you need to put water in slow cooker with chicken?

There’s no need to add water when making my recipe for slow cooker whole chicken because when the chicken is cooking in the crock pot, it creates a broth. Definitely use that broth to flavor the meat and keep it moist for when you save it for leftovers.

Do you need to cook chicken before putting it in a slow cooker?

While chicken is meant to be slow cooked from raw, many do like to just brown or sear it first. Browning and draining liquids before slow cooking can help this issue too. Many, like me, slow cook for convenience. Having to pre cook before slow cooking can take away from this convenience.

Does a slow cooker use a lot of electricity?

A slow cooker is a very efficient way to cook a hot meal. The average 3.5 litre slow cooker uses about 1.3 kWh of electricity or 21p to power eight hours of cooking – that’s less that 1p per hour.
